Package: cvs2svn
Version: 2.3.0-2
Severity: minor
Tags: patch

Attached, a patch for cvs2bzr.1 that fixes the top of the page, and
replaces .IP with .P throughout for more readable formatting.

Changes: 
 cvs2svn (2.4.0-1) unstable; urgency=low
 .
   * New upstream release.
   * Convert to 3.0 (quilt) source format.
   * Update to Standards-Version 3.9.3:
     - add build-arch and build-indep targets,
     - move to dh_python2 .
   * Generate manpages instead of using handwritten ones (closes: #624535).
